Step 1: Initial Setup and Installation

Start with site preparation: ensure a level, stable foundation or transport chassis. For stationary units, pour a concrete pad; for mobile units, secure the trailer. Connect the plant to a three-phase power supply per local codes. Calibrate the weighing sensors using the included manual; this step is critical for accurate batching. The manufacturer provides a commissioning engineer for turnkey orders, which simplifies the process immensely.

Step 2: First-Time User Guide

Power on the control panel and familiarize yourself with the touchscreen interface. The system initially runs in manual mode for testing. Set your aggregate bins and cement silo levels. Perform a dry run with no material to verify motor rotation, conveyor direction, and sensor feedback. The learning curve is moderate—most operators become comfortable within two shifts.

Step 3: Core Functions and Daily Use

In automatic mode, input your mix design recipe (e.g., proportions of sand, gravel, cement, water). The plant automatically feeds aggregates, weighs them, and transfers them to the mixer. Monitor the batch consistency on the display. For best results, always pre-wet the mixer drum before the first batch and maintain proper moisture content in aggregates.

Step 4: Advanced Techniques

Use the recipe library to store common mix designs for quick recall. Experiment with the moisture compensation feature—this adjusts water addition based on real-time aggregate moisture readings, improving consistency. The manual allows for fine-tuning the mix cycle time, which can increase throughput by up to 15 percent.

Step 5: Maintenance and Care

Daily: inspect the mixer blades for wear and check belt tension. Weekly: lubricate all bearings and clean the weighing hoppers. Monthly: calibrate the pressure sensors and inspect electrical connections. The industrial equipment maintenance guide on our site provides additional insights for long-term care.

Step 6: Troubleshooting Common Issues

If batches are inconsistent, check the sensors for material buildup. If the mixer stalls, reduce the batch size or check aggregate moisture. For control errors, reset the system and ensure all safety interlocks are engaged. When in doubt, contact YG support via the provided WhatsApp number (+86 138 3716 1201).

Expert Tips for Maximum Value

Tip #1: Optimize Mix Design

Use the recipe library to create baseline mixes for your most common projects. This reduces setup time for repeat batches and ensures consistency.

Tip #2: Implement Daily Calibration

Spend 10 minutes each morning verifying sensor readings against a known weight. This simple step prevents costly inaccuracies over the day.

Tip #3: Invest in Complementary Equipment

A concrete mixing system performs best with a good quality water meter and aggregate moisture sensor—both relatively inexpensive upgrades.

Tip #4: Plan for Seasonal Adjustments

In cold weather, preheat your water and use the system’s heating circuit for the mixer. In hot weather, add ice to the batch to maintain workability.

Tip #5: Schedule Regular Maintenance

Create a calendar for monthly bearing greasing, quarterly sensor calibration, and annual mixer blade replacement. Preventive care extends equipment life significantly.

Tip #6: Use the Manual for Fine-Tuning

The manual includes hidden settings for cycle time reduction and moisture compensation. Experiment with these to find your optimal balance of speed and quality.

Tip #7: Train Multiple Operators

Ensure at least two people on your crew can operate the system confidently. This avoids downtime if the primary operator is unavailable and helps share knowledge.

Common Mistakes to Avoid

  1. Mistake: Skipping site preparation. Solution: Always ensure a level, reinforced concrete pad for stationary plants to prevent structural stress and misalignment.
  2. Mistake: Ignoring aggregate moisture. Solution: Calibrate moisture sensors weekly and adjust your batch recipe accordingly to prevent slump variations.
  3. Mistake: Overloading the mixer. Solution: Never exceed 90 percent of the rated capacity—overloading reduces mix quality and increases wear on the blades.
  4. Mistake: Delaying maintenance. Solution: Stick to the recommended schedule; a single skipped calibration can result in batches that fail strength tests.
  5. Mistake: Using incorrect power supply. Solution: Verify your three-phase voltage matches the plant specification. Mismatched power can damage controllers and void warranties.
